Block

#21,637,094
Block Number
21,637,094 @ 05/10/2025, 18:01:50
Status
Finalized
ID
0x014a27e64131bf2e272562e74ac337dc381ea315dcd99ecf7da3595ce655a613
Transactions
Gas Used
3150462/40000000 (7.88% Used)
Total Score
2,113,084,899 (+98)
Rewards
10.86 VTHO